Output 38d3089f00d4d3bde684b0865faf8ed3aeecb1a19f28dca57d8c64cbf11faadc:17

value
146981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f344bfb0d27de917f2c2893fa4ac68403a5705b OP_EQUAL
address
3EkDCcxjuyr5ARLoFmKKhZ8WpNtXu4BqyH
transaction
38d3089f00d4d3bde684b0865faf8ed3aeecb1a19f28dca57d8c64cbf11faadc
spent
true